Rowland Norment Elementary is a State/Public serving elementary age pupils, located in Lumberton, Robeson County. The school has 446 pupils enrolled. It is part of the Public Schools of Robeson County school district. It serves grades Pre-Kโ3 in a small-town setting. The school employs 29.6 full-time-equivalent teachers, a student-teacher ratio of 15.1:1. 32% of students are proficient in reading. 22% are proficient in maths. Rowland Norment Elementary enrolls 446 students across grades Pre-Kโ3. The student body is 54% male and 46% female. A teaching staff of 29.6 full-time-equivalent teachers supports the school, giving a student-teacher ratio of 15.1:1.
By race and ethnicity, the student body is 45% Black or African American, 25% Hispanic or Latino and 15% American Indian or Alaska Native.

443 of the school's 446 students (99%) q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. Of these, 443 qualify for free lunch and 0 for a reduced price. The school participates in the National School Lunch Program. Free and reduced-price lunch eligibility is a widely used indicator of the share of students from lower-income households.
Rowland Norment Elementary is located in a small-town setting (NCES locale: Town, Distant). The school runs a schoolwide Title I program, which provides federal funding to support students from low-income families. Rowland Norment Elementary is one of 37 schools in Public Schools of Robeson County, based in Lumberton, North Carolina. The district serves 21,301 students district-wide and employs 1,309 full-time-equivalent teachers. With 446 students, Rowland Norment Elementary is smaller than the district average of about 576 students per school.
